Release checklist — Tallyforge inventory reconciliation

Confirm the nightly reconciliation job ran clean against the Ostermark warehouse dataset. Zero unmatched SKUs required before sign-off. If drift exceeds threshold, block the release and ping the data team. Verified run must come from the candidate pipeline, not a local rerun. Candidate build follows below.

build token for kagaf-hahof: htk14_9d3d4d26d7d8de

Ticket: Config drift on Pondermere bloom filter

Hey — welcome aboard. The bloom filter sitting in front of the Lodestone KV store has drifted from what's in the repo: prod shows a bigger bit array and a different hash count than staging. Rebuilds are failing intermittently as a result. Please reconcile against the intended values, which are listed below.

service settings:
[silwyn]
host = silwyn.crelvogrid.internal
user = silwyn_svc
database = silwyn_prod

# Break-Glass: Catalog Cache Invalidation

Scope: the Pinrow product catalog at Veldstone Retail. If stale prices persist after a purge and the Hollowmere invalidation queue is wedged, use break-glass to flush the edge tier directly. Contractors: get verbal sign-off from the catalog lead first. Steps: open the Hollowmere admin shell, select emergency-flush, confirm the tenant, and run it once — repeated flushes thrash the origin. Access is logged and expires after 20 minutes. Unseal the admin shell with the passphrase below.

recovery phrase for kahop-tajog: istix-casvan

// Clock skew between the Harkness build agents has caused
// signed-request timestamps to drift outside the Tollgate
// service's 30-second acceptance window, failing uploads
// intermittently. We now fetch server time from Tollgate's
// /time endpoint and offset each request rather than trusting
// the agent clock. The client below needs the internal
// Tollgate credential, which follows on the next line.

API key for fahip-kahip: zpat23_XiJGUHz5xfaAtaIqUkus0rh